Jiangsu electricity price hikes pressure steelmakers
Jiangsu province in China has decided to implement electricity price increase policies for steel companies that have not achieved ultra-low emissions standards, Kallanish notes. The policy will be imposed incrementally to encourage companies to achieve ultra-low emissions.
